MOOCs and Open Education Around the World. Routledge – 2015 – 396 Pages.
Edited by Curtis J. Bonk, Mimi M. Lee, Thomas C. Reeves, Thomas H. Reynolds.

MOOCs and Open Education is a
book
that
analyzes
topics
relating to open
educational resources
(OERs) and
massive open online courses (MOOCs).
The latest
improvements in
blended learning technology are providing the means for
students
in every nation on earth
to be participants in courses via the Internet.
These massive online courses are
almost always free
but do not
always
lead to formal accreditation.
